🧬 Compound Overview
SS-31 (also known as a mitochondria-targeted peptide) is a short-chain peptide engineered to interact within cellular environments in research models. Because of its structure, it is frequently examined in studies involving mitochondrial dynamics and cellular energy systems.
In addition, it is valued for its stability and reproducibility in controlled experimental conditions.
⚗️ Research Applications
SS-31 is intended strictly for scientific and laboratory research use only. Therefore, it is not for human consumption or medical application.
Although research focus may vary, it is commonly studied in:
- Mitochondrial function research
- Cellular energy pathway studies
- Oxidative stress laboratory models
- Biochemical interaction analysis
